City of Meeting of the Elk River Parks and <br /> Elk � Recreation Commission <br /> River Held at the Elk River City Hall <br /> Wednesday, September 14, 2016 <br /> Members Present: Chair Anderson, Commission members Ahlness, Holmgren, <br /> Niziolek, Nystrom,Kallemeyn, and Sagan <br /> Council Liaison: Ms. Wagner <br /> Staff Present: Parks and Recreation Director,Michael Hecker, Recreation Manager, <br /> Steve Benoit,Park Maintenance Supervisor,Tim Sevcik, and <br /> Recreation Coordinator,Tonya Love <br /> I. Call Meeting to Order <br /> Pursuant to due call and notice thereof, the meeting of the Elk River Parks and <br /> Recreation Commission was called to order at 6:30 p.m. by Chair Anderson. <br /> 2. Consider 9/14/16 Agenda <br /> Moved by Commissioner Sagan and seconded by Commissioner Kallemeyn <br /> to approve the September 14 2016, Parks and Recreation Commission <br /> meeting agenda. Motion carried <br /> 3.1 Consider 8/10/16 Regular PRC Minutes <br /> Moved by Commissioner Kallemeyn and seconded by Commissioner Ahlness <br /> to approve the following August 10,2016 Parks and Recreation Commission <br /> Minutes. Motion carried 7-0. <br /> 4. Open Forum <br /> Debbie Chanthanouvang, 10648 184th Ave. NW talked about issues in the Trott <br /> Brook Park and putting in motion sensor lighting along the parkway to help cut <br /> down on the violence and crime. Police have been called may times. <br /> 5. Recognition of former Commissioner Charles Schuldt <br /> Commissioner Sagan recognized former Commissioner Charles Schuldt for his <br /> service on the Parks and Recreation Commission and extended his deepest <br /> sympathies to the family. <br /> 6.1 Eagle Scout Presentation <br /> Eagle Scout Rand Carlson presented his Eagle Scout project to build a 1/2mile trail <br /> in Hackberry Loop in Woodland Trails Park. <br />
